About Perla Village
Perla is a small village in Khundian tehsil, in the district of Kangra, Himachal Pradesh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 141, made up of 71 males and 70 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 986 females per 1000 males. The village covers 58.16 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 147603,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Perla
The census records public bus service for Perla as Available within 10+ km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within <5 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
